Discovering Varanasi's Steps : History, Rituals, and Charm
Varanasi's famous ghats, a series of brick steps leading down to the sacred Ganges River, offer an profound glimpse into the essence get more info of India. Historically, these ghats have served as important sites for spiritual practices, witnessing centuries of tradition. Observe the daily pattern of life unfold: the morning cleansings, the evening prayers, and the poignant scene of cremation processes that highlight the transience of life. Every ghat possesses its own unique tale and personality, ranging from the grand Dashashwamedh Ghat, known for its elaborate ceremonies, to the quieter Assi Ghat, a favored spot for dawn prayers and contemplation. Aside from their spiritual significance, the ghats present a breathtaking display of construction and a lively tapestry of human connection.

Kashi Travel Tips: Navigating the Ghats and Discovering Serenity
Visiting Varanasi can feel intense, especially when dealing with the labyrinthine network of ghats leading down to the holy Ganges. Pro Tip: early mornings are ideal for experiencing the sunrise ceremonies and avoiding the biggest masses. Don't aggressively receiving offers from touts; a polite "no, thank you" usually is enough. For a genuine find some tranquility, explore away from the main Manikarnika Ghat and seek out the smaller, less busy ones – you might just find a moment of profound quiet. Note that: respectful attire and thoughtful approach will enrich your experience immensely.
